Recovery of coefficients for a weighted p-Laplacian perturbed by a linear second order term
This paper considers the inverse boundary value problem for the equation ∇ ⋅ (σ∇u + a|∇u|p−2∇u) = 0. We give a procedure for the recovery of the coefficients σ and a from the corresponding Dirichlet-to-Neumann map, under suitable regularity and ellipticity assumptions.
